About me
Antonio M. Coronado (they/them/elle) is Professor of Practice and Co-Coordinator of Community Legal Education Programs at Innovation for Justice, housed at the University of Arizona James E. Rogers College of Law and the University of Utah David Eccles School of Business. Antonio co-leads Innovation for Justice’s suite of Justice Worker programs, training and certifying community advocates in three civil legal practice areas across Arizona and Utah. They serve on the executive board for the Law and Society Association's Collaborative Research Network 19 and focus their scholarship on critical legal empowerment as well as democratizing the legal profession.
